Job Description

You’ll own a mix of strategic content projects (1–4 weeks) and quick ad-hoc admin/ops tasks. Strategic work includes researching, drafting, and publishing blog posts, creating and scheduling LinkedIn content, and occasionally setting up new tools (e.g., a CRM). Ad-hoc tasks are smaller items added to your backlog (e.g., “create a feedback form,” “update the company bio”), where you’ll execute quickly, communicate status, and close the loop.
